In this video, we solve a unity feedback control system step by step and determine the closed-loop transfer function. Starting from the block diagram, we carefully derive the transfer function, simplify the expression, and compare it with the standard second-order system form. You will learn how to: • Find the closed-loop transfer function • Determine the natural frequency (ωn) • Calculate the damping ratio (ζ) • Identify whether the system is stable or unstable • Classify the system as underdamped, overdamped, or critically damped For this system, we show clearly why it is stable but underdamped, and what that means physically in terms of oscillations and overshoot. Let’s solve this control systems exercise together: find the steady-state value of the step response of the system illustrated in the block diagram. Comprising the closed-loop system architecture are the following fundamental components that allow for self-correction: * The Controller (G_c): The “brain” that processes the signal. * The Process or Plant (G): The physical system we are trying to influence. * The Output Transducer (H): Often a sensor that measures the output and feeds it back to the start. 🔄 The Power of Feedback Without feedback, a system is “blind” to external disturbances. Feedback allows us to compare where we are (Output) with where we want to be (Reference Input). If there is any difference between the two, the system drives the plant, via the actuating signal, to make a correction. In this specific problem, our output transducer, or sensor, has unity gain, which means that H(s)=1. This is a special case where the actuating signal is precisely the error signal as it is the actual difference between the input and output. ⏱️ Efficiency via the Final Value Theorem One of the most elegant tools in a control engineer’s toolkit is the Final Value Theorem (FVT). Usually, finding the steady-state behavior of a system would require us to perform an Inverse Laplace Transform to get back into the time domain, y(t), and then calculate the limit as t approached infinity. FVT lets us skip the heavy lifting. By analyzing the behavior as s tends to 0 in the frequency domain, we can predict the system’s long-term “resting point” without ever leaving the s-plane. #electrical #electricalengineering #controlsystem #electronics

Let’s solve this control systems exercise together: find the closed-loop transfer function of the system illustrated in the block diagram. To reduce multiple subsystems into a single block, the transfer functions of parallel systems are added, and cascaded (series) systems are multiplied. For negative feedback systems, the closed-loop transfer function is given by G(s) / [1 + G(s)H(s)], where G(s) is the system in the forward path and H(s) is the system in the feedback path. #electrical #electricalengineering #controlsystem #electronics
